A bill to prohibit States and localities that seek to impede the free formation of education pods from receiving Federal emergency education funds, to provide a teacher expense deduction for home educators, and for other purposes.
Protect Parent Organized Direction of Students Act
This bill prohibits states and localities that regulate the free formation of educational pods from receiving federal emergency education funding for COVID-19 (i.e., coronavirus disease 2019) relief. An educational pod refers to a small group of three or more students at the elementary or secondary school level who are from more than one family and learn together in person outside of the school.
In addition, the bill temporarily expands the tax deduction for certain expenses of elementary and secondary school teachers to include certain home educators.
